Le jeudi 24 juillet 2008, Jonathan Nieder a écrit :
t6030-bisect-porcelain.sh relies on "ls" exiting with nonzero
status when asked to list nonexistent files.  Unfortunately,
/bin/ls on Mac OS X 10.3 exits with exit code 0.  So look at
its output instead.
